The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Apple sauce Pouch and Green Giant Riced Veggies Cauliflower side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
Apple sauce Pouch is the more energy-dense option here, packing 43 more calories per 100g than Green Giant Riced Veggies Cauliflower.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.
However, watch out for the sugar content. Apple sauce Pouch contains significantly more sugar (11.1g) compared to the milder Green Giant Riced Veggies Cauliflower (2.35g). If you are monitoring your insulin levels or trying to cut down on sweets, Green Giant Riced Veggies Cauliflower is undeniably the healthier pick.
